Geneva from A Pair & A Spare found some dollar store rugs made from recycled jersey cloth and, noting that they had a good deal of stretch to them, decided they would be the perfect material for a form-fitting dress. The look is totally high-end, and especially impressive considering the source! Seriously, would you ever guess? [how to make a multicolor bodycon dress]
Project estimate:
- Rag rugs, $4 and up
- Zipper, on hand or $1 and up
- Sewing machine, on hand
Total: $4 and up
